PhD student in Automatic Control - Linköping University

PhD student in Automatic Control - Linköping University

Your work assignments

The research area of this position is complex networks and multiagent dynamics, with special focus on human decisions and opinion dynamics. The research will deal with both theoretical and computational aspects. The student will develop dynamical models and apply them for instance to socio-technological networks.

The Division of Automatic Control has a strong commitment to WASP (Wallenberg AI, Autonomous Systems and Software Program). This recruitment is potentially eligible for affiliation with the WASP graduate school.

As a PhD student, you devote most of your time to doctoral studies and the research project of which you are part. Your work may also include teaching or other departmental duties, up to a maximum of 20% of full-time.

Your qualifications

You have a Master’s degree in electrical engineering, engineering physics, computer science, applied mathematics or have completed courses with a minimum of 240 credits, at least 60 of which must be in advanced courses within the topics mentioned above. Alternatively, you have gained essentially corresponding knowledge in another way. The degree requirement must be met no later than at the time the employment decision is finalized, which occurs when the employment contract is signed.

Furthermore, you shall be eager to learn new things and explore the unknown, and you like to pay attention to details. You must also have strong communication skills in English, both in writing and orally.
